Foundation Moisture Prevention in Fredericksburg, VA
Foundation moisture prevention services focus on managing excess water around a property’s foundation to help protect it from damage caused by moisture infiltration. These services typically include installing drainage systems, such as French drains or downspout extensions, and applying waterproofing solutions to the exterior or interior of the foundation. Projects often involve addressing issues like basement dampness, mold growth, or cracks resulting from water pressure, ensuring the foundation remains stable and dry over time.
Homeowners usually seek foundation moisture prevention when experiencing signs of water intrusion or preparing for new construction or renovations. It’s important to understand the specific moisture challenges of a property, such as poor drainage, high groundwater levels, or inadequate grading, before requesting these services. Proper assessment can help determine the most effective solutions to maintain a dry, stable foundation and protect the overall integrity of the building.

Common Foundation Moisture Prevention Jobs
Foundation moisture prevention - techniques to reduce excess soil moisture around the foundation.
Drainage system installation - adding or upgrading gutters and downspouts to direct water away from the foundation.
Soil grading services - regrading landscape slopes to prevent water pooling near the foundation.
Waterproofing solutions - applying sealants and barriers to protect basement and foundation walls from moisture intrusion.
Sump pump installation - setting up systems to remove accumulated water from basement or crawl space areas.
Moisture barrier placement - installing vapor barriers to control humidity levels and prevent moisture buildup inside the foundation.
Foundation Moisture Prevention Questions
What causes foundation moisture issues? Excess moisture can result from poor drainage, high groundwater levels, or inadequate grading around the property.
How can moisture affect a foundation? Moisture can lead to cracks, shifting, and deterioration of the foundation over time.
What are common signs of moisture problems? Signs include damp basement walls, mold growth, or uneven flooring.
What preventive measures help protect a foundation from moisture? Proper drainage, waterproofing, and soil grading are effective ways to reduce moisture risks.
